What are the responsibilities and job description for the Advanced Practice Nurse - Full Time In Person position at Enlightened Recovery?
The Advanced Practice nurse provides medical oversight, training, and direct patient care.
- Implements medical protocols for Enlightened Recovery in consultation with Medical Director and Director of Nursing.
- Assesses and evaluates through completion of H&P with patients and records diagnostic impression within 24 hrs. of patient arrival/admission
- Signs off on lab results and medication orders in a timely manner.
- Reviews health medications on admissions and updates prescriptions as needed.
- Provides on-call services to 24-hour nursing staff.
- Conducts continual treatment plan management and evaluation in a timely manner.
- Knows and implements the company’s policies and procedures.
- Collaborates with interdisciplinary team and provides input into treatment planning and care coordination
- Provides consultation to nursing staff regarding chronic medical disease, addiction and/or mental health concerns with patients.
- Demonstrates the ability to communicate and effectively interacts with people across cultures, ranges of ability, genders, ethnicities, races, etc.; demonstrates the ability to successfully deliver culturally responsive services; and manages any cultural related issues of patients as it pertains to the intern position.
